As a '76 grad of USAFA and a dad of a 05 USNA grad and a current cadet at USAFA, I can say that the quality of military academy cadets and midshipmen is not declining.

Below are the numbers for the USAFA Class of 2009:
2009 Demographics:
Applications 9601
Offers 1746
Males 1149
Females 241(17%)
Minorities 260(19%)
Athletes 320(23%)
Avg GPA 3.90
Avg SAT 1280

Please note these are AVERAGE numbers for class entry. Also if you haven't lettered in a sport or led either as a High School class officer or been a community leader, don't bother applying.
